The 3 months correlation between Goldman and MSCI is 0.62.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ding The Goldman Sachs and MSCI Inc in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on MSCI Inc and Goldman Sachs is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on The Goldman Sachs are associated (or correlated) with MSCI.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of MSCI Inc has no effect on the direction of Goldman Sachs i.e., Goldman Sachs and MSCI go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Goldman Sachs and MSCI
The main advantage of trading using opposite Goldman Sachs and MSCI posit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Goldman Sachs position performs unexpectedly, MSCI can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
